Phase retrieval using Alternating Minimization
• Work by Praneeth Netrapalli, Prateek Jain and Sujay Sanghavi.
• Use random matrices for sensing signals.
• Requires 𝒪(𝑛 𝑙𝑜𝑔3𝑛) measurements for successful recovery.
• Two main features • Initialization
• Convergence

Signal recovery
• Non-convex optimization problem
• Not convex because entries of 𝐂 are restricted to be diagonal with ‘phases’ of form 𝑒𝑖𝜃 and hence magnitude 1.
Alternatively update 𝐂 and 𝒙

PhaseLift (Overview)
Trace-norm relaxation
𝒜:
𝒜−1:
𝑿 = 𝒙𝒙∗ ( 𝑿 = rank 1, 𝒙 = original signal) Measurement:
Measurement operation:
Adjoint operation:
• Signal recovery from phase-less measurements: (requires 𝑚 = 𝒪(𝑛 log𝑛))
• Signal and measurement model:
Lifting up the problem of vector recovery from quadratic constraints into that of recovering a rank-one matrix from affine constraints via semidefinite programming.

Scalability Issues
• Dependence of 𝑚 on 𝑛 when 𝑛 is large ~104
𝑛 log 𝑛~105 , 𝑛 (log 𝑛)3~107
• Use signal’s structure to reduce the number of measurements
Compressive phase retrieval 𝑚 = 𝒪( 𝑘 log
𝑛
𝑘 ) where 𝑘 is the sparsity of signal
If 𝑛~104, 𝑘~102 then 𝑘 log𝑛
𝑘 ~102

Comparison
Method Sample complexity (m)*
AltMinPhase 𝑛 log3 𝑛
PhaseLift 𝑛 log 𝑛
Efficient CPR 𝑘 log𝑛
𝑘
*for n-length k-sparse signal
